Miles & Barr Estate Agents in Ashford is seeking a motivated Sales Valuer to join their dynamic team. The role involves:

  • Conducting property inspections
  • Preparing valuation reports
  • Analysing market trends
  • Providing excellent customer service

The ideal candidate will have:

  • At least 2 years of sales experience
  • Exceptional communication skills
  • A valid driving license

The salary package is competitive, offering up to 40k OTE, and the company values its team members.

How to prepare for a job interview at Miles & Barr Estate Agents

Know Your Market

Before the interview, brush up on current property market trends in Ashford. Being able to discuss local market conditions and how they affect property valuations will show that you're not just knowledgeable but also genuinely interested in the role.

Showcase Your Sales Experience

Prepare specific examples from your past sales experience that highlight your success. Whether it’s closing a tough deal or exceeding targets, having concrete stories ready will demonstrate your capability and confidence as a Sales Valuer.

Practice Your Communication Skills

Since exceptional communication is key for this role, practice articulating your thoughts clearly and concisely. Consider doing mock interviews with a friend or family member to refine your delivery and ensure you come across as approachable and professional.

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the team culture at Miles & Barr or how they support their valuers in staying updated with market changes. This shows your enthusiasm for the position and helps you gauge if it’s the right fit for you.
